Maybe: At age 40, clots could be due to hormonal changes, or they could be due to a fibroid in the uterus or cervix, or a polyp in the uterus or cervix. Without an ultrasound it's not really possible to determine why you passed the clots. Any woman your age with heavy bleeding, however, needs to see a physician to be evaluated for a possible uterine biopsy. See an ob/gyn.
